ScorpEvo ZS 1024 turbo+ CF-HDD/FDD/Mouse/SMUC 3.1/ProfROMse/NeoGS/ZC
Speccy-2007 128/AY/TR-DOS
Сайт с документацией к "Scorpion ZS 256"
Лучше сделать и жалеть, чем не сделать и жалеть.
Некоторые из моих поделок тут: https://github.com/serge-404
ScorpEvo ZS 1024 turbo+ CF-HDD/FDD/Mouse/SMUC 3.1/ProfROMse/NeoGS/ZC
Speccy-2007 128/AY/TR-DOS
Сайт с документацией к "Scorpion ZS 256"
По поводу I2C, аппаратный контроллер уже написал, сейчас в отладке. Т.к. чип юзается на нижнем уровне иерархии, то аппаратную эмуляцию любого другого на среднем уровне некто не мешает сделать, как это сделано в конфигурации u9Speccy.
По поводу другого таракана, можно вместо PCF8583P (Clock/calendar with 240 x 8-bit) установить DS1307N (64 x 8 Serial RTC) или DS1338 (I2C RTC with 56-Byte NV RAM). Если пренебречь байтами энергонезависимого статического ОЗУ. Как подключить вывод 3(Vbat) решите сами.
---------- Post added at 09:04 ---------- Previous post was at 08:52 ----------
Сейчас занят написанием арбитра для кеширования SDRAM. Для начала хочу сделать кеш прямого отображения. Т.к. проц в основном молотит только циклы чтения, то выигрыш в производительности будет ощутимый, правда придется пожертвовать RRAM (16К Cache + 2K Tag). Это так, просто интересно...
Так в том и дело, что ваще не хочется этого I2C, а не просто хочется именно Dallas. Ну к чему эти усложнения - что у нас более интересных проектов нет ,чтобы в этих I2C ковыряться? А иначе ковыряться придется, т.к. я не сторонник того, чтобы делать решения, которые работают только в ПЛИС.
Завтра пойду в Чип-Дип, там сейчас DS1302 по 50 рублей. Типа налетай - подешевело.
Думаю, прикольно было бы сделать так: схемно подключаться будет прям к тем же выводам схемы подключения 512ВИ1 (т.е. или одна или другая, а вся прочая обвязка максимально такая же), и соответственно висеть на том же самом порту. И будет программно автодетектиться - что у нас там на этом порту - ВИ1 или DS1302.
Лучше сделать и жалеть, чем не сделать и жалеть.
Некоторые из моих поделок тут: https://github.com/serge-404
Направлю тему в правильное русло. Несколько дней бьюсь над добавлением режима МХ. Вставил прошивки Теста_МХ и 27 кБайтный ROM-диск с RAMFOSом и своими программами. Начало теста вижу так - всё в красном цвете. Должно быть всё красочно. ROM-диск вообще никак не включается. Ещё вставил в атач схему селектора адресов, которая работала на реальном компе. В ней все выходящие сигналы инверсные.
Последний раз редактировалось fifan; 12.02.2011 в 19:24.
Вот результат дневных ковыряний. Что на фотках не так?
ScorpEvo ZS 1024 turbo+ CF-HDD/FDD/Mouse/SMUC 3.1/ProfROMse/NeoGS/ZC
Speccy-2007 128/AY/TR-DOS
Сайт с документацией к "Scorpion ZS 256"
Все квадратики в Тесте памяти должны быть красными. А после запуска теста идёт равномерное окрашивание экрана разными цветами? В RAMFOSе после появления этого экрана по F6 идет вывод файлов на экран?
ScorpEvo ZS 1024 turbo+ CF-HDD/FDD/Mouse/SMUC 3.1/ProfROMse/NeoGS/ZC
Speccy-2007 128/AY/TR-DOS
Сайт с документацией к "Scorpion ZS 256"
Эту тему просматривают: 1 (пользователей: 0 , гостей: 1)